Walking Goals for Routes
Walking goals turn a route into a clear mission without making the walk feel complicated.
What this feature does
Streets supports goals that match the way people actually walk: discover a few new streets, hit a distance target, walk for a set amount of time, reach a step goal, or aim for a calorie target. During the route, Streets shows goal progress and can notify you when the goal is complete.
